Hello, 

Could someone help me with filing an online tax return.

I have reached the balance sheet continued page and have no idea what's going wrong with capital and reserves. 

How am I suppose to fill in the boxes?

we don't have called up share capital as it has been spent?

Forget about the tax return until you have completed your accounts. Your called up share capital figure is the number of shares you have in issue multiplied by their nominal value.  If you don't know what those two numbers are, or come to think of it, even if you do, you should get an accountant to prepare your company's accounts for you.  It will save much time and money in the long run.
